Let’s be honest: performance reviews are a pain in the you-know-what. Team members don’t like them, and most managers aren’t fans either — 45 percent of managers didn’t think reviews were suitable gauges of a team member's performance, compared to last year’s 39 percent, according to a poll by Globoforce.
